Per MarstadI found this in Norway.
Diameter 1 - 2 mm, dark inside.
Conidia 28-45 x 13-16 my.
Growing on decidious wood, probably Fraxinus excelsior.

I collected one of the N. American species on Acer saccharum (P. acerophilum or acerinum, I can't remember) in 2016. It was late summer and very dry, nothing much to collect in the forest, when I saw a dead sugar maple with dark spores erupting through the bark. It was quite impressive, producing 3-4 cm long sori all over the surface of the tree.
